Ticket: Staging env misconfigured for Siftgate bloom filter

The bloom layer in front of the Pellet KV store is rejecting all lookups in staging because the env file was copied from the dev template without credentials. False-positive tuning values are fine; only the auth line is missing. To unblock the weekly demo, the Pellet admission secret must be set on the following line.

env line for yaguf-fajop: LEDGER_TOKEN13=fb08984397349

## Break-Glass Access: Reset Flow Revamp

During the migration of the Hallowmere password reset flow, plugin authors may encounter locked staging tenants. Break-glass access is intended only when the reset token service is unreachable and a demo or certification run is blocked. Document the timestamp and reason in the Orvess access log, notify the on-call steward within one hour, and revert entitlements afterward. Unsealing the break-glass vault requires the recovery passphrase below.

recovery phrase for fajep-yaweg: gilath-sorox-wenius-rusdor-keliel-zorius

## Authentication

The CastCheck feed validator authenticates every request to the internal FeedForge service before fetching or validating podcast feeds. Contractors should use the shared staging credential rather than generating their own; production keys are issued separately after onboarding review. Export it in your shell before running the test suite. The staging credential is listed below.

service key, fawip-bajef: kto11_Qt5wZK9vdNC

Batch of twelve certified calibration weights from Merrow Instruments ships Monday. Cases are foam-lined; keep upright, no stacking. Each case carries a seal number matching the transfer sheet — verify all twelve before the driver departs. Temperature is not critical; shock is. Route goes direct to Ferncastle Metrology Lab, no intermediate stops, no consolidation with other loads. Driver signs the chain-of-custody sheet at both ends. Coordinator relays the following line to the courier at hand-over.

dispatch memo: the lamwyn fenwyn courier leaves the wenir ledger at gate 7175 under passcode 822969